        I am not sure about the alt tab issue the two of you have been having, this has not been happening to me. However for the issue you have with programs crashing FFXI, I do know how to fix that.

         

        Go to Control Panel and search "UAC"(User Account Control) then bring it down to the second level. This will still give you warnings when programs attempt to make changes and such but it won't dim your screen which is what causes the game to crash.
